  - A use-after-free issue was discovered in libwebm through 2018-02-02. If a Vp9HeaderParser was initialized
    once before, its property frame_ would not be changed because of code in
    vp9parser::Vp9HeaderParser::SetFrame. Its frame_ could be freed while the corresponding pointer would not
    be updated, leading to a dangling pointer. This is related to the function OutputCluster in webm_info.cc.
    (CVE-2018-6548)
